Mastering Emotional Control for Consistent Decision Making
In the heat of an online blackjack game,emotions can become unpredictable allies or risky saboteurs,influencing choices and ultimately swaying outcomes. Cultivating emotional discipline requires more than just willpower; it demands a strategic mindset that recognizes emotional triggers before they spiral. Begin by identifying moments that typically provoke anxiety or overconfidence—such as a big win streak or a crushing loss—and prepare mental checkpoints to pause and reassess. This mental self-awareness empowers players to welcome clear logic over knee-jerk reactions, allowing decisions to be rooted in probabilities rather than feelings.
Building emotional resilience also involves practical techniques that anchor your mind amidst the virtual noise:
- Mindful Breathing: Short breath exercises to reduce impulsivity.
- Pre-Decision Reflection: Take a brief moment to weigh risks before placing bets.
- Set Loss Limits: Defining boundaries prevents chasing losses emotionally.
emotion | Risk | Control Strategy |
---|---|---|
Overconfidence | bluffing reality | Pause & re-evaluate odds |
Frustration | Risky bets to recover losses | Set strict loss limits |
Anxiety | Hesitation and missed opportunities | Mindful breathing |
Understanding Cognitive Biases That Influence Betting Patterns
When it comes to online blackjack,players often fall prey to subtle mental shortcuts that skew their judgment and betting choices. These automatic tendencies, known as cognitive biases, can significantly affect how a player approaches risk and reward. Such as, the Gambler’s fallacy convinces players that after a run of losses, a win is “due,” prompting irrational increases in bet size. Conversely, the Confirmation Bias leads players to focus only on outcomes that support their belief in a winning strategy, while disregarding contradictory data. Recognizing these biases is the first crucial step towards making more informed, strategic decisions rather than impulsive, emotionally driven moves.
Understanding these psychological pitfalls is not just academic—it can be structured into practical applications. Here’s a quick guide outlining common biases and how to counter them:
Bias | Description | Counter Strategy |
---|---|---|
Gambler’s Fallacy | Belief that past losses predict future wins. | Stick to a predetermined betting plan to avoid emotional bets. |
Confirmation Bias | Ignoring losses and focusing only on wins. | Keep an objective log of all outcomes, wins and losses alike. |
Anchoring | Relying too heavily on the first piece of information. | Reassess strategies regularly rather than sticking to initial beliefs. |
Loss Aversion | Fear of losing causes overly cautious or riskier bets. | Set clear thresholds for loss limits and take breaks to reset mindset. |
Incorporating awareness of these biases helps create a more disciplined, less emotionally charged gaming experience. When players learn to navigate their own mental patterns, the path to consistent, strategic blackjack play becomes clearer and far more rewarding.
